Young Archaeologists’ Club (YAC): Artefact conservation

Discover the fascinating world of artefact conservation with our Young Archaeologists’ Club, designed for enthusiasts aged 8 to 16!

Join community archaeologist Alexis in this practical session to learn how archaeologists ensure that fragile objects they excavate are preserved and protected from further damage. Explore the techniques used to recreate pottery vessels from small fragments and get hands-on experience with conservation methods. This session is perfect for young history buffs eager to understand the care and skill involved in preserving our past.
